Less a review, more a recommendation and a note of thanks to all at the Bahnhofsmission. I had no idea who you were or what you did when I first walked through the doors of your café in Frankfurt. I had been sleeping rough in the woods on the far side of the Maine for 6 months and getting by on pfand....the deposit refund scheme on cans and bottles. A scorching summer turned into a damp autumn, and then winter started to set in. A fellow rough sleeper told me we could get a coffee and some warmth courtesy of your café near the station. I popped in often when cold, wet and feeling down. I was told that the mission could help foreigners return home. I asked a member of staff about this. She checked my passport and asked if I was free to travel at short notice. I was...and at two thirty that afternoon I was on a bus back to London. THANK YOU EVERYONE...you were so kind and breathtakingly efficient.
IF you are lost and alone in any town or city with a Bahnhofsmission, I highly recommend you pop in. A good coffee, get warm and who knows what may happen. Danke schoen mein freunds. read more
